Transaction 7563c34f6c2608a831a7310f82e7f4b34a7b335ae7034b1e8b302e81e537e752
1 Input
2 Outputs
- 7563c34f6c2608a831a7310f82e7f4b34a7b335ae7034b1e8b302e81e537e752:0
- 7563c34f6c2608a831a7310f82e7f4b34a7b335ae7034b1e8b302e81e537e752:1
value 376128
address 18uFTHEA5x99pMLbJ45ZkhG5CY2etmaYvn
value 13721501
address 3M4qbuVQkaThAgL1fuAhCDvVvDZVAAWJ5Z